Children & Family Resource Center has announced that Joel Johnson and Emily Balcken have accepted key leadership roles at the center.
Johnson holds a master’s degree in mathematics education from Western Carolina University and a Post-Baccalaureate Certification in Financial Accounting from the University of North Carolina at Asheville.
Most recently, Johnson worked for Lake Logan Conference Center as the business manager and prior to that served as director of finance for Advantage Home and Community Care for over 15 years.
Johnson will oversee all aspects of the Children and Family Resource Center’s financial management and administrative systems and will ensure they are in line with strategic goals.
READY! kits with books, activities offered to incoming HCPS kindergartners
Community volunteers put together 1,100 READY! kits full of kindergarten readiness activities Friday.
Henderson County Public Schools and local early education partners are wanting to provide the kits to give incoming kindergartners tools they can use at home to prepare for their first year of school, according to a HCPS news release.
The kits include books, crayons, clay, safety scissors, Unifix cubes and activity sheets. They will be distributed by each elementary school by the end of this school year.
HCPS also developed a three-part series of “Kindergarteners Can!” videos to provide an introduction to what school will look like. The videos are available on the district’s YouTube channel, website, Facebook and Twitter.
Charitable giving partnership announces awards
In its fifth year of providing support for local nonprofits, the Horizon Heating & Air and Hannah Flanagan’s Charitable Giving Program has expanded for 2021, adding partners Southern Alarm & Security and home comfort system manufacturer Trane. This year’s program selected 23 nonprofits to receive grants.
“I feel very fortunate to be able to give back to this wonderful community each year and am excited our partnerships are growing with the addition of Southern Alarm & Security and Trane,” Horizon owner Dan Poeta said. “We are all excited to be supporting 23 organizations with charitable grants this year.”
